Story summary
- A NIH-funded study shows that young athletes experience significant brain changes from repeated head impacts years before CTE symptoms emerge.
- Researchers observed a 56% loss of specific neurons in athletes under 51, despite no tau protein buildup.
- Increased microglial activation correlated with prolonged exposure to contact sports.
- The study suggests early cellular damage, indicating potential for earlier CTE diagnosis and treatment.
- Findings stress the need for better protective measures in contact sports to reduce long-term brain injury risks.
